1. Walt Disney Studios: The House of Magic

When discussing popular entertainment studios, Disney is not just a participant; it is the benchmark. Founded in 1923, Disney has mastered the art of intellectual property (IP) management. Their productions range from hand-drawn classics to the highest-grossing sci-fi epics.
